State of the Shake
Here’s what we did last week.
Yearly subscriptions.Significantly sped up page loading by generating summaries of counts.In short: perma-link pages went from 100ms to 20ms to load. What this also means is we can now present total views/likes/saves on your files. We’re doing that this week.Speed.Oh yeah!Release the API.GO GET IT.
Here’s what we’re doing this week:
Add Facebook sharing button.Did this in the morning. Seems to be working but if you have any feedback about it we’d appreciate it.- Bookmarklet. Finally, a way to share files and videos without a plugin. Also good for when you’re on a mobile device.
- New user welcome pages, home page, and finding people and shakes to follow pages.
- User counts: total likes, views, and shared files.
- List of shakes on their user page.
- Making it clearer on friend shakes where the file also lives (e.g, User shake)
I think I’m missing something. We’ll update this page if anything changes. We do still want to add the ability to rotate an image and auto-rotate if there is orientation data. The priority is just lower.
